excel vba if array not empty
Free VBA Course: Using Arrays in VBA , Two-dimension Array, Dynamic Array, ubound, array, split, join.Excel does not accept variables in declarations. Instead, declare a dynamic array (using empty parentheses), then define its dimensions using Redim getting array data from a filtered list in vba daily dose of excel. delete blank cells in excel vba easy excel macros. vba worksheet functions 5 ways to easily use excel functions in vba.excel vba check if array is not empty. I can confirm that UBound raises the runtime error 9 "Subscript out of Range" on an empty array in all Excel versions from 95 to 2016. If it doesnt for you, its either not the UBound function youre calling (is it blue in the source code?) or the array is not empty. There is a slim chance that an Office VBA bug When using Arrays in Excel VBA you sometimes need to test whether the array is empty or not.Office > Excel VBA > Excel VBA: How do I test for an empty array check if you have an empty array: Ciarano: VB database (1377). django (2192). excel (2130). firebase (1897). html (7517).I am extremely new to VBA.
I am currently creating a script that will save me a lot of time fingers crossed.Posted on February 23, 2018Tags arrays, loops, vba. Section 1.1: Opening the Visual Basic Editor (VBE). Section 1.2: Declaring Variables.End Sub. The array is passed to the routine that lls the cells with the song name or null value to empty them. First, an. Complete Excel VBA Tips Secrets for Professionals. You are currently viewing the Excel VBA section of the Wrox Programmer to Programmer discussions.I want to loop through an array while the array element is not empty. Say I have an array of 3 elements An array is empty or unallocated if it is a dynamic array that has not yet been sized with the ReDim statement or thatThis module contains procedures that provide information about and manipulate VB/ VBA arrays. For details on these functions, see www.cpearson.
com/excel/VBAArrays.htm . Sub emptyarray() Dim arr1() As Variant. If IsEmpty(arr1) Then MsgBox "hey" End If.Not the answer youre looking for? Browse other questions tagged excel- vba or ask your own question. Excel VBA: Creating Hyperlinks Type Mismatch. 0.Python iterate through array while finding the mean of the top k elements. How can I find out what surprise my wife wants? excel, formula, array, vba, function.Alexa Rank: 121,766 Google PR: 3 of 10 Daily Visits: 3,537 Website Value: 25,466 USD. Video by Topic - Excel Vba If Array Not Empty. Excel VBA how to find an empty cell? What is the formula to remove blank cells without affecting other columns in MS Excel 2013?What are the similarities and differences between arrays and pointers? Array is Not Empty End If.Array to Excel Range. 26. Excel VBA Performance - 1 million rows - Delete rows containing a value, in less than 1 min. 0. How to return an array, of varying length, from a VBA Function. MsgBox "Empty Range" Else MsgBox "Not Empty" End IfAnd please, keep asking questions as youApplication was the pre Excel 97 way of doing it and is retained for compatibility, but there areFunctions not exposed by the WorksheetFunction object usually have a VBA equivalent (e.g LeftDim ans As String. On Error Resume Next ans WorksheetFunction.VLookup("value", table array, 2 Collapse. No announcement yet. VBA: Arrays - empty or not?Hi all, OK, in a nutshell the question is "Is there a simple way (either built-in to Excel or via a UDF) to determine whether an array is empty?" Vba excel check array empty spaces, Is there an easy way (without having to loop through the whole array) to check to see if an array has any empty/blank values loaded into it? i want to. Variant containing an empty array b Array() MsgBox GetElementsCount(b) 0 . Any other types, eg Long or not Variant type arrays MsgBox GetElementsCount(c) -1.How do I slice an array in Excel VBA?Excel 2003 VBA I have a workbook generated by others where I am trying to classify the sheets into Dynamic Arrays of Sheet Names.strTypeB(UBound(strTypeB)) aSheet.Name. End Select Next aSheet. Now, how do I get the Count of the array elements if the array is EMPTY! Welcome to the ultimate Excel VBA Tutorial (Visual Basic for Applications)! You will walk the journey from being an VBA Zero to becoming an VBA Hero. Another solution to test for empty array. if UBound(ar) LBound(ar) then msgbox Your array is empty! Excel vba match value in array and if not match then add into the array. Excel - Check a specific value within a range. C - Check if a value is a number. Excel 2010 VBA change a table value in a for loop (Solved). Can vba return excel cell value with formats. Array is Not Empty End If. Public Function IsEmptyArray(InputArray As Variant) As Boolean.MS Excel Spreadsheet is the best Office Software, Excel VBA and Excel Formulas make Spreadsheet work faster. So its not empty, but it doesnt have any values.one cell from a number in another cell How to chart multiple data sets in Excel mac 2011 Cycle a vba function through all workbooks in a folder How to count appearances of a number in a Different sheet? How can i check in vba if variant is empty. isarray or vartype vbarray doesnt work.LVL 93. Microsoft Excel62. Visual Basic Classic33. Rory Archibald.MsgBox "Array was empty" Else. do something else End If On Error GoTo 0. The next thing I want to do is print out only the supplier names listed in that array. Hence I have to create an If statement that will only be entered when the item in the array does not have the value "null" and when the array is not empty. Several objects in Excel or VBA libraries and their properties result in a 1-dimensional or multi dimensional array.result is an empty array asp, recognisable by its upper limit (Ubound) value -1. Check the occurrence of an item in a 1-dimensional array. If there are two different public functions with the same name in a single VBA project, the following compilation error is thrown: Compile error: Ambiguous name detected: functionname. Returns: Variant() The source 2D array without empty rows. excel vba if statement. When using Arrays in Excel VBA you sometimes need to test whether the array is empty or not.Whereas no error suggests the array is not empty. So, to test the Lbound you could use the following the VBA code. ThisArray would simply be replaced with your array name. Excel VBA - Create an Array - 3 ways Ill show you three different ways to create an array in Excel VBA and Macros and how to get the data out of those aClearing Blank (but Not Empty) Cells - Excel. Use If To Return A Truly Blank Cell - Excel. ms excel vba is not empty excel vba delete blank or empty rows 5.check if array is empty vba excel stack overflow. Name Excel vba check if array is not empty is the worlds number one global design destination, championing the best in architecture, interiors, fashion, art and contemporary. How do I check if array value is empty?How do I convert the integer value 45 into the string value 45 in Excel VBA? How do I create an empty solution in Microsoft Visual C 2010 Express? check if array is empty (vba excel) - These if then statements are getting the wrong results in my opinion.I want to loop through an array while the array element is not empty. Sub emptyarray() Dim arr1() As Variant.New to Excel so excuse me if I explain something wrong, happy to clear up any Qs in the comments, my VBA is most likely awful but I was only asked to do this yesterday for the first time. check if array is empty (vba excel) - Arr1 becomes an array of Variant by the first statement of your code: Dim arr1() As Variant Array of size zero is not empty, as like an empty box exists in real world. Excel array formulas, functions and constants - examples and guidelines Not only can an array formula deal with several values simultaneously, it can also return Select an emptyentirely. JKP Application Development Services, Circular references in Excel. Excel VBA for Financials (Dutch) A updated if I How to avoid using Select in Excel VBA. 0. Excel VBA: Find value in a multi-dimensional array. 5. Excel Find a sheet based on name.VBA Variant - IsNull and IsEmpty both false for empty array. 1. Excel vba variant array reusable, must be erased? - Because the array data elements is always updated and exported in MS Excel, the last empty cell in column A is not fixed. Is this doable and many thanks in-advance. Learn how to use Microsoft Excel and Visual Basic for Applications now.In this VBA Tutorial, you learn how to check if a cell or range is empty. This VBA Tutorial is accompanied by an Excel workbook containing the data and macros I use in the examples below. I have read a solution here VBA count non empty elements of array. However I think there may be a better way or function to perform it. To count non- empty cells in a range (A1:J10), we use this in Excel VBA. Download excel file excel magic trick lookup first non empty cell in range lookup last number in range  Search Through Cells Containin Using Vba Excel Programming.Excel Vba Check If Array Index Is Empty. Tag: arrays,excel,vba,excel-vba. I have the below code that adds values to an array if it meets a criteria.I am trying to clear the values accumulated in the array and empty it at the end of the columns loop Excel Questions. VBA if not empty. Become a Registered Member (free) to remove the ad that appears in the top post.Dim arr As Variant, i, x arr Array(string1, string2, string3, string4) For i 0 To 3 If arr(i) <> "" Then x x 1 Next If x <> 1 Then MsgBox "Error". Empty array vba. Basic Matrix and Vector Functions written with VBA/Excel - February 19th,2018.
Checks if empty array returns True if array is empty. - error if input argument Arr is not an array. Here if FileNamesList array is empty, GetBoiler(SigString) should not get called at all. When FileNamesList array is empty, SigString is also empty and this calls GetBoiler() function with empty string.Category: Excel Tags: vba. Getting Started with Arrays in Visual Basic for Applications A good overview over arrays in VBA can beTheres also a post with examples about using arrays to work with Excel cell values andIf you pass nothing to the Array function, itll return an empty array. In this case, the upper boundary of the Heres a simple, complete solution: Recommendvba - How to check if a date cell in Excel is empty. alue of the cell again.| You can use the below function to check if variant or string array is empty in vba. Function IsArrayAllocated(Arr As Variant) As Boolean. will be 0 for an unallocated, empty array. On these occassions, LBound is 0 and . UBound is -1. To accomodate the weird behavior, test to .How to avoid using Select in Excel VBA. arrays vba excel-vba. share|improve this question.IsArrayEmpty This function tests whether the array is empty (unallocated). Returns TRUE or FALSE. Jul 4, 2016. Looking for More Excel Tutorials? VBA Code Library. Check if a value is in an array with this VBA function.If the value is not in the array or the array is empty, the VBA function returns false.